Alexandria, VA: Time-Life Books, 1991. Book. Near Fine. Hardcover. Reprint Edition. 332pp. Black imitation leather, silver page edges, satin placemarker ribbon, apparently unread. Reprint of the 1930 edition. A series of essays by Doyle on the subject of mediums and spiritualism. This is a volume in the "Collector's Library of the Unknown Series". Contains a loose insert from Time-Life editors and a loose unused name label. Near Fine.
